在数字化时代,应用程序(APP)已经成为人们生活中不可或缺的一部分。一个优秀的APP不仅功能强大,更需要在界面设计上做到人性化,让用户能够轻松找到所需功能。本文将揭秘高效界面设计的原则,帮助开发者打造出用户友好的APP布局空间。
一、用户需求分析
在开始界面设计之前,首先要明确用户的需求。了解目标用户群体的年龄、性别、职业、使用习惯等,有助于设计出符合他们期望的界面。以下是一些常见的用户需求:
- 简洁性:用户希望界面简洁明了,避免过于复杂的设计。
- 易用性:用户希望操作简便,快速找到所需功能。
- 美观性:用户希望界面美观大方,提升使用体验。
- 一致性:用户希望不同功能模块的风格保持一致。
二、布局原则
1. 优先级布局
在界面设计中,根据功能的重要性进行优先级布局至关重要。通常,重要的功能或内容应放置在显眼的位置,如屏幕顶部或中心位置。
示例代码:
```html
<div class="priority-layout">
<div class="important-function">重要功能</div>
<div class="less-important-function">次要功能</div>
</div>
2. 网格布局
网格布局可以帮助用户快速识别界面元素的位置。通过将屏幕划分为网格,可以更好地组织内容,使界面更加有序。
示例代码:
```css
.container {
display: grid;
grid-template-columns: repeat(3, 1fr);
grid-gap: 10px;
}
.item {
background-color: #f0f0f0;
padding: 20px;
text-align: center;
}
3. 对齐原则
对齐是界面设计中的一项重要原则。合理的对齐可以使界面看起来更加整洁,提升用户体验。
示例代码:
```css
.container {
display: flex;
justify-content: center;
align-items: center;
}
.item {
margin: 10px;
}
三、色彩与字体
1. 色彩搭配
色彩搭配对界面设计至关重要。合适的色彩可以提升视觉效果,同时传递出品牌特色。
示例代码:
```css
body {
background-color: #f5f5f5;
color: #333;
}
.header {
background-color: #007bff;
color: #fff;
}
2. 字体选择
字体也是影响界面设计的重要因素。选择合适的字体可以提升阅读体验,同时保持界面风格的一致性。
示例代码:
```css
body {
font-family: 'Arial', sans-serif;
}
.header {
font-family: 'Helvetica', sans-serif;
}
四、交互设计
交互设计是界面设计的重要组成部分,它直接影响用户对APP的满意度。
1. 按钮设计
按钮是用户与APP交互的主要方式。设计按钮时,应注意以下原则:
- 大小适中:按钮不宜过大或过小,以免影响操作。
- 形状简洁:按钮形状应简洁明了,避免过于复杂的图形。
- 颜色突出:按钮颜色应与背景形成对比,便于用户识别。
示例代码:
```html
<button class="button">点击我</button>
2. 导航设计
导航设计应简洁直观,让用户能够快速找到所需功能。
示例代码:
```html
<nav>
<ul>
<li><a href="#">首页</a></li>
<li><a href="#">关于我们</a></li>
<li><a href="#">联系我们</a></li>
</ul>
</nav>
五、总结
高效界面设计是打造成功APP的关键。通过以上原则,开发者可以打造出用户友好的APP布局空间,提升用户体验,从而在竞争激烈的市场中脱颖而出。记住,设计并非一成不变,不断优化和调整是提升APP品质的重要途径。
